    Abstract

    Image compression for low bit rates will loss edge characteristic seriously, which will influence subsequent recognition and comprehension to the image. Hence, how to preserve the edges of the image when compressing the image becomes an urgent problem. In order to solve this problem, an image compression algorithm is proposed. This algorithm first extracted the edges of the image and encoded the edges based on the compression of wavelet Contourlet transform, and then reconstructed the edge preserved image by the edge preservation rule. The experiment results demonstrated that our algorithm could preserve the edges more completely, and keep the value of image contrast index higher. As a result, our algorithm is propitious to enhance the degree of comprehending the reconstructed image content under low bit rates reconstruction condition.
